Registration and Arrival - Arrival time is from 12:00 AM - 11:59 PM. - While each park attempts to accommodate your exact spot request, the on-site manager has the ultimate decision for spot placement. Guest Policy - As a courtesy to your neighbors PLEASE DO NOT walk through sites other than your own. - Persons found responsible by resort staff for disorderly conduct or vandalism will be asked to leave the resort. - Guests are responsible for all losses, damage, and/or injury to persons or property caused intentionally or by their own negligence. Quiet Hours - Observed between 8:00 PM and 8:00 AM. Children Policy - Children are welcome with an accompanying adult. - Children age 5 and under stay free. - Children are always welcome and must be escorted by their parents, guardian, or responsible adult at all times in resort buildings. - Escorting adult is responsible for ensuring that children comply with rules and applicable regulations. Pet Policy - Pets are welcome. - Pets must be on a leash at all times. - It is your responsibility to pick up and clean up after your pet. - No animals in buildings except service animals. - Unsafe or noisy dogs are not permitted. - Limit 2 pets per site. Right of Way - ATVs, bicycles, and horses are permitted on marked pathways only. - Please show proper riding courtesy. Illegal Activities - The use of alcoholic beverages or marijuana by minors under the age of 21 years is prohibited. - Illegal drug use by anyone will not be tolerated. Cleanliness - Please keep a clean campsite. - Because cleanliness is very important to pleasant camping, we ask your co-operation in keeping restrooms and showers neat and tidy at all times. - Showers and restrooms are not to be used for cleaning pots, dishes, laundry, or recreational equipment. - Receptacles are provided in convenient locations for all trash, please use them. Firewood Rules - Available at the pavilion. - Buy it where you burn it! - Live trees, vegetation, or firewood of any sort may not be brought into or taken out of the resort. Vehicle and Parking Policy - Park on the designated pad. - Do not park on grass -- additional parking is available in designated areas. - No unattended RVs or vehicles of any type may be left overnight without prior approval. - No vehicle washing.
